The shortest path between two points is called a geodesic. In flat (Euclidean) space it is simply a straight line.

A line is a straight path that extends infinitely or endlessly in opposite directions. A straight path that joins two points is called a line segment.

A straight path that has a beginning but no end represents a ray in geometry. A ray starts at a specific point (the beginning) and extends infinitely in one direction.
